Centos7配置普通用户不加sudo直接运行docker命令

发布时间 2023-05-27 11:09:34作者: 柯衍

平时普通用户执行docker命令都要在docker命令前加上sudo就挺麻烦的,咱们把普通用户执行docker要加的sudo去掉.

设置用户组

sudo groupadd docker

如果出现groupadd : cannot open /etc/group,则使用以下两行命令解锁,如果没有则不需要运行,直接跳过即可

sudo chattr -i /etc/shadow
sudo chattr -I /etc/group

设置docker组可以访问docker

sudo glassed -a ${USER} docker. # 将当前用户加入组docker
sudo system to restart docker
sudo Chloe a+rw /var/run/docker.sock

若有操作解锁步骤,则完成添加组操作后,将锁加回去

sudo chattr +ia /etc/shadow
sudo chattr +ia /etc/group